What to do if Touch VPN won’t connect on Windows 10?
1. Check if you have the latest Touch VPN version
As Windows 10 regularly receives updates, please make sure you have the latest version of Touch VPN. You need to keep your VPN software up to date in order for it to work properly with the latest version of Windows.
Go to the Microsoft Store and check whether there is any update for this software. If so, please install the available updates.

3. Reset Touch VPN
Another solution could be to reset Touch VPN. In order to do this, please follow the steps described below:
- Open Start menu and go to Settings
- Click on Apps and then go to Apps & Features
- Select Touch VPN
- Click Advanced Options and afterward click Reset
- Restart your computer.
4. Check if SSL and TLS are enabled
If SSL and TLS are disabled, this may explain why your Touch VPN is not working. So, please make sure to check this part as well. In order to check this, please follow the instructions listed below in order to enable these features manually.
- Go to Control Panel
- navigate to Internet Options
- Click on Advanced
- Enable SSL and TLS, as shown in the screenshot below.

7. Update Network drivers
If you still can’t use Touch VPN on your Windows computer, try updating your network adapter drivers.
- Launch Device Manager > locate Network Adapters
- Uninstall WAN Miniport (IP), WAN Miniport(IPv6) and WAN Miniport (PPTP).
- Now, click on the Action menu and select Scan for hardware changes
- Windows 10 will install the latest version of the ports you just uninstalled.
8. Run the Internet Troubleshooter
Touch VPN may fail to connect due to incorrect or missing Internet settings. Fortunately, Windows 10 features a series of built-in Internet troubleshooters that you can use to automatically fix connection problems.
- Go to Settings > Update & Security > Troubleshoot
- Locate and run the following troubleshooters (one by one): Internet Connections, Incoming connections, and Network Adapter.
- Reboot your computer and check if Touch VPN works properly.
